1.2.4 Connection of safety sensors
1.2.4.1 General
The following applies to the sensors o f the SM300, version VA 1.xx:
ƒ Sensor type and function cannot be parameterised.
ƒ The sensor signals are converted into PROFIsafe bit information and
transmitted to the master control for processing. A local evaluation is
not carried out.
ƒ Unused sensor inputs must not be connected. The PROFIsafe bit of a
non-connected input is in the OFF state.
Note!
Make sure that an internal contact function test is carried out at
thesafeinputs:
Safe input in the ON state
ƒ ALOWlevelatone channel puts the input in the OFF state.
The discrepancy monitoring starts simultaneously.
ƒ A LOW level must be detected at both channels within the
discrepancy time, otherwise a discrepancy error will be
reported.
ƒ To be able to confirm the discrepancy error, a LOW level must
be detected before at both channels.
Safe input in the OFF state
ƒ A HIGH level at one channel starts the discrepancy monitoring.
ƒ A HIGH level must be detected at both channels within the
discrepancy time, otherwise a discrepancy error will be
reported.
ƒ To be able to confirm the discrepancy error, a HIGH level must
be detected before at both channels.
